Julian Erosa vs Melquizael Costa report

Who won Erosa vs Costa?

Melquizael Costa beat Julian Erosa by unanimous decision in their 3 round contest during the main card of UFC Fight Night, on Saturday 17th May 2025 at UFC Apex in Las Vegas.

The scorecards were announced as 29-28, 29-28, 29-28 in favor of the winner Melquizael Costa.

The fight was scheduled to take place over 3 rounds in the Featherweight division, which meant the weight limit was 145 pounds (10.4 stone or 65.8 KG).

Erosa vs Costa stats

Julian Erosa stepped into the octagon with a record of 31 wins, 11 losses and 0 draws, 12 of those wins coming by the way of knock out and 14 by submission.

Melquizael Costa made his way to the cage with a record of 23 wins, 7 losses and 0 draws, 7 of those wins coming by knock out and 8 by submission.

This was Julian Erosa's 17th fight in the UFC, having made his debut for the promotion in 2015. Melquizael Costa marked his 7th fight for them, having made his own debut for the promotion in 2023.

Julian Erosa's UFC record stood at 9-8-0, while Melquizael Costa's came in at 5-2-0.

The stats suggested Erosa had a slight advantage in power over Costa, with a 39% knock out percentage over Costa's 30%.

If the fight went to the ground, their records suggested Erosa had a slight advantage over Costa, with a 45% submission rate over Costa's 35%.

Julian Erosa was the older man by 7 years, at 35 years old.

Erosa had a height advantage of 3 inches over Costa.

Erosa was the more experienced professional fighter, having had 12 more fights, and made his debut in 2010, 3 years and 5 months earlier than Costa, whose first professional fight was in 2014. He had fought 28 more professional rounds, 97 to Costa's 69.

Erosa vs Costa form

Erosa had beaten 3 of his last 5 opponents, stopping 1 of them, going to the judges twice.

In his last fight before this contest, he had won against Darren Elkins at UFC 314 on 12th April 2025 by knockout in the 1st round at Kaseya Center, Miami, United States.

Previous to that, he had beaten Christian Rodriguez at UFC Fight Night: Namajunas vs. Cortez on 13th July 2024 by submission in the 1st round at Ball Arena, Denver.

Going into that contest, he had defeated Ricardo Ramos at UFC Fight Night: Ribas vs. Namajunas on 23rd March 2024 by submission in the 1st round at UFC Apex, Las Vegas.

Before that, he had lost to Fernando Padilla at UFC Fight Night – Song vs. Simon on 29th April 2023 by knockout in the 1st round at UFC Apex, Las Vegas.

He had been beaten by Alex Caceres at UFC Fight Night: Cannonier vs. Strickland on 17th December 2022 by knockout in the 1st round at UFC Apex, Las Vegas.

Melquizael Costa had beaten 4 of his last 5 opponents.

In his last fight leading up to this contest, he was victorious against Christian Rodriguez at UFC Fight Night: Moreno vs. Erceg on 29th March 2025 by unanimous decision in their 3 round contest at Arena CDMX, Mexico City, Mexico.

Previous to that, he had won against Andre Fili at UFC Fight Night: Cejudo vs. Song on 22nd February 2025 by submission in the 1st round at Climate Pledge Arena, Seattle, United States.

Going into that contest, he had beaten Yilan Sha at UFC Fight Night: Perez vs. Taira on 15th June 2024 by submission in the 3rd round at UFC Apex, Las Vegas.

Before that, he had been defeated by Steve Garcia at UFC Fight Night: Song vs. Gutierrez on 9th December 2023 by knockout in the 2nd round at UFC Apex, Las Vegas.

He had defeated Austin Lingo at UFC Fight Night – Holm vs. Bueno Silva on 15th July 2023 by unanimous decision in their 3 round contest at UFC Apex, Las Vegas.
